What is the appetite out there for me to develop a mobile wallet for Biblepay?
Id like to submit a proposal for it but its a BIG task and the budget this time around is all out.
Quite frankly id love to set apart one month to work on biblepay fulltime

But I wanted to get a feeler from others if they would want such a thing?

https://www.reddit.com/r/BiblePay/comments/7esc05/mobile_wallet/

Thanks Togo. Thats 1 vote! Hopefully they own a sanctuary for funding LOL

Do you recommend I break this down into separate deliverables?
And include it in the next budget cycle? Is it every 2 weeks?

I recommend creating a semi-detailed proposal and sharing the URL, and include how many hours are attributed to each step and lets review it.  Since we dont have to create this from scratch (I assume you would port the electrum client over to work on biblepay) it would be good for us to see the hours estimation on each step before asking the network to vote on it.

I think it will be very important to deliver each deliverable every two weeks so we can see how its coming along, something that is checked in to github and demoable.

The budget is monthly.

One other thing to do the due diligence on is try to find out who is going to run the electrum server, and the hours associated with making it work with biblepay and the monthly charges to run one.
